As soon as you arrive, many kids and young men will come to you offering their service as a guide. I'm not very fond of guides, but if you really want to find something in the old town you better go with a guide. They can also take you to specific shops, which are rather "hidden" for touristic standards.
I arranged one for 6 USD who would take me the followinh day to see all the madrassas, shrines, tombs, houses... We met early in the morning and he took me around in the morning. Showed me the famous houses, we visited some kind of private houses typically harari, saw a few artists shops... I payed him 3USD, and arranged to meet him after lunch. But after lunch he never appeared back so I went wandering around the old town in the afternoon.
I tried to find again the places we had seen in the morning (I had even taken notes on their locations) but it was impossible, all the alleys seemed the same, all the gates similar, all the courtyards identical!!
